Choosing and starting a subscription

What a subscription actually buys you, monthly versus yearly, and how to pick the right tier.

A subscription buys three things: a monthly credit allowance, higher limits, and access to automation features. It does not pay for creator work, that is separate real money.

What to pick

If you are…Start on
A brand testing whether creator marketing works at allFree
A brand running a few campaigns a monthPro
A brand treating creators as a real channel, with a teamBusiness
An agency or multi-brand teamEnterprise
A creator applying to a handful of briefsFree
A creator pitching brands weeklyCreator Pro
A creator running a deal pipeline with automationCreator Elite

Monthly versus yearly

  • Yearly is materially cheaper per month on every paid tier.
  • Credits still land monthly on a yearly plan, they are not front-loaded.
  • Start monthly if you are unsure. Switching to yearly later is easy, unwinding a year is not.

Subscription credits expire, bonus credits do not

Your monthly plan credits are for that cycle and expire at the end of it. Signup, referral and purchased credits never expire.
